From 788b1abbdc75d6bc727be65fc107fb10eaa484b6 Mon Sep 17 00:00:00 2001
From: zss <zss@example.com>
Date: 星期二, 30 七月 2024 20:04:10 +0800
Subject: [PATCH] 模版变更,下单的界面设置区间,如果填写0.48*0.5的时候筛选条件用0.48,下单的模版查看根据委托单位进行筛选,如果委托单位为空就可以查看所有

---
 framework/src/main/java/com/yuanchu/mom/config/PowerConfig.java |    5 ++++-
 1 files changed, 4 insertions(+), 1 deletions(-)

diff --git a/framework/src/main/java/com/yuanchu/mom/config/PowerConfig.java b/framework/src/main/java/com/yuanchu/mom/config/PowerConfig.java
index 2018aef..bc08492 100644
--- a/framework/src/main/java/com/yuanchu/mom/config/PowerConfig.java
+++ b/framework/src/main/java/com/yuanchu/mom/config/PowerConfig.java
@@ -30,6 +30,9 @@
     @Override
     public boolean preHandle(HttpServletRequest request, HttpServletResponse response, Object handler) throws Exception {
         if(handler instanceof HandlerMethod) {
+            if(request.getRequestURL().toString().contains("/error") || request.getRequestURL().toString().contains("/outPath")){
+                return HandlerInterceptor.super.preHandle(request, response, handler);
+            }
             HandlerMethod h = (HandlerMethod)handler;
             ValueAuth annotation = h.getMethodAnnotation(ValueAuth.class);
             if(annotation!=null){
@@ -38,7 +41,6 @@
             JSONObject obj = JSONUtil.parseObj(new Jwt().readJWT(request.getHeader("token")).get("data"));
             Integer userId = Integer.parseInt(obj.get("id") + "");
             int i = authMapper.isPower(userId, h.getMethod().getName());
-
             if (i == 0){
                 throw new ErrorException(obj.get("name") + " 鏃犳潈闄愯闂� " + h.getMethod().getName() + " 鎺ュ彛");
             }
@@ -54,5 +56,6 @@
     @Override
     public void afterCompletion(HttpServletRequest request, HttpServletResponse response, Object handler, Exception ex) throws Exception {
         HandlerInterceptor.super.afterCompletion(request, response, handler, ex);
+
     }
 }

--
Gitblit v1.9.3